Villarreal vs Girona Preview, prediction, lineups, betting tips & odds | LaLiga 2025-26

The Yellow Submarine will take on the White and Teds on matchday 2 in the LaLiga
When the Catalan-based team Girona come to Estadio de la Ceramica for their second league match in the La Liga 2025-26 on Sunday, Villarreal will be hoping to use their home advantage to win back-to-back games. On the opening day of the campaign, Villarreal were very impressive as they beat the newly promoted Real Oviedo by 2-0.
Villarreal didn’t change their squad a lot for this season, and they have been quiet in the Summer transfer window. As Marcelino seeks to build on what was an impressive fourth-place finish in the League, they qualified for the Champions League. They will have to be very well prepared to get three points against Girona on Sunday.
The Catalan team had a brilliant 2023-24 season, but after that, they have massively regressed to a relegation battle side. Last season, they somehow were able to survive and stay in the top division, and will hope to have a better season this time.
Michel has remained in charge of the club, and he and his coaching staff are under immense pressure to deliver results. They lost to Rayo Vallecano by 1-3 at home in the first game, and will hope to bounce back from that defeat against Villarreal. This will be a mouthwatering clash for sure.

Players to Watch
Pape Gueye (Villarreal)
Gueye has outstanding defensive qualities, as he is always strong in duels, and he plays with courage on the field. He has a high work rate on the pitch and runs throughout the game. With his long legs, he is able to intercept passes and stop players in the attacking areas.
The Senegalese international is not an elite passer, but he is still good with the ball and does not panic in pressure situations. Gueye is a perfect team player who gives his best on the field.
Jhon Solis (Girona)
Solis is one of the young players to watch this season for Girona, as he has been part of the team for the last two seasons and has improved a lot in these years. Now he has become a regular starter for the team and will play a key role in the midfield.
The Colombian youth international is a proper box-to-box midfielder who does his attacking and defending job very well on the ground. He will have to be at his best in the upcoming fixture, as Villarreal’s midfield has got some really good players.
